Ig Metall: Union Wants to Fight for Acc Battery Cell Factory

Summary by Manager Magazin
Following ACC's investment freeze in Kaiserslautern, the IG Metall union intends to negotiate with Mercedes-Benz, Stellantis, and Totalenergies to ensure the battery plant is still built. The union insists the land must not be sold under any circumstances.

FRANKFURT a. M. The IG Metall wants to fight for the construction of the battery cell plant of the company ACC in Kaiserslautern. "There is no better location nationwide if you really want battery cell production," said the chairman of the union district Mitte, Jörg Köhlinger. There is a fully developed location, funding commitments and a qualified workforce with a negotiated collective agreement. [...]
